### **1. Material and Construction**
These waders are made from **100% PVC**, a material known for its **waterproof and abrasion-resistant properties**. PVC waders are typically heavier than modern alternatives like neoprene or breathable fabrics, but they excel in durability, especially in harsh environments. The military-grade construction suggests they were designed for tough conditions, making them suitable for fishing in rocky rivers, marshes, or muddy banks.

The **green vintage design** from the 90s adds a unique aesthetic, appealing to those who prefer retro gear. However, the lack of breathability could be a drawback for extended use in warm weather, as PVC tends to trap heat and moisture inside.

### **4. Durability and Longevity**
Given their military background, these waders are built to last. PVC resists punctures from sharp rocks or branches, making them a solid choice for rugged terrains. However, over time, PVC can become brittle, especially if stored improperly or exposed to extreme temperatures. Proper maintenance—such as cleaning and storing them in a cool, dry place—can extend their lifespan.
